logo

Output 663073043217e1d9111df1f2234516a1de1a150c3b11aed50ba80cefaa320a74:0

value
149223278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fba35077517760b398f176229e4cf959b70eebfb OP_EQUALVERIFY OP_CHECKSIG
address
1PwYFRnf7HxfYM9kxP4dAfrgLmpzfyS2Vt
transaction
663073043217e1d9111df1f2234516a1de1a150c3b11aed50ba80cefaa320a74